Wheelchair fencing is one of the sports that were “born” to help out with the rehabilitation of World War II veterans. What mostly fills the audiences of this spectacular Paralympic sport with awe and admiration is the fact that the wheelchairs, on which athletes compete, are fixed in position in a frame on the piste! Students will have the opportunity to try the sport out and become familiar with the ingenuity, patience and adaptability required of a wheelchair fencing athlete.
